I had the same issue in mine. The cannons are straight through, with no real “baffle” as you would see in other pipes. After putting in a Woods 22X cam, it was way louder. The 22X is similar to the RS468 cam, but less lopey. It was obnoxious loud. Not a bad sound, just loud. There are only a couple three ways I’ve found to remedy this. You can get a set of CVO pipes on eBay. Use them stock or get the full sac kit for them stock CVO, you will notice a slight power drop, but it’s quieter. Full sac will be a bit louder but not as loud as the cannons (I used two inch baffle).third option is to buy the CVO cans from 2017 only. They are part number 64900256, and 64900257. These are a one year only CVO pipe that is straight through but much quieter than the cannons. These are what I use on daily basis beings I ride to work at 0500, and don’t wanna **** off the neighborhood. I also have a set of the fullsac pipes and use those when i want the best performance and noise isn’t a concern for the neighbors.
